Brooklyn Signature Hybrid
Brooklyn Bedding’s signature hybrid mattress is a favorite. They’re made of a durable bed that’s also thick but soft and neutral. Because the firmness level can easily be adjusted to suit your needs, it’s suitable for all types of sleepers and bodies. It’s one of the best coil mattresses that you can find.
Brooklyn Bedding uses the TitanFlex foam. This foam blends memory foam with the responsiveness and flexibility of latex. You may want to have a medium or soft firmness. You can choose a 1.5-inch TitanFlex top and a 1-inch VariFlex Transition layer to provide more compression support.
Imagine that you want a firmer mattress. In that case, you can switch the TitanFlex top layer while making the VariFlex transition layer into 2 inches. To add edge support, there are 8-inch perimeter coils placed on foot and head and on both sides of the mattress.

Brooklyn Sedona Hybrid
Brooklyn Sedona Hybrid may be the right choice for you if you want a more balanced feel in your memory foam. It’s designed to cool you while you sleep. The mattress measures 14 inches in total. The bed’s primary support is provided by the 8-inch pocketed coils. The 1-inch transition foam helps soften the mattress from the coils. Then, there are numerous layers of memory and responsive foam to balance the feel of the whole mattress.

Brooklyn Spartan Hybrid
Athletes and active people have different sleeping requirements. Six layers make up the Spartan Hybrid. These include a dense poly foam layer, 8 inches of quantum edge pocketed coils, topped with another layer of dense polyfoam.
It’s also covered with the Nanobionic RE-3 Performance cover, which helps convert your body’s natural heat to energy. When it hits the covers, it reflects your body, allowing you to cool down while you sleep.

FAQ
Do they offer warranty?
Brooklyn Beddings has a 10-year warranty for their mattresses. Their other products also have warranties, but their length may vary. It’s best to ask if they offer a warranty for their mattress protectors, covers, masks, and weighted blankets.
How long does it take for the mattresses to fully expand?
After you take the mattress out of the box, it will expand in a matter of minutes. This can take from 3 to 5 hours. Sometimes, however, it can take up to 24 hours for the entire process to complete. Even if it does, the expansion process doesn’t stop after 24 hours.
Once the mattress is delivered, make sure you unpack it from the box. Although the mattress is tightly compressed, it will be more difficult to move once it expands. It is best to unpack it in the room you intend to place it.

Is it possible for the mattress to be returned?
Brooklyn Bedding offers a free 120-day trial. If you’re not satisfied with their mattress, you can return it, and they’ll give you a refund. You will need to keep the mattress with you for at least 30 days.
For the refund, you might be required by Brooklyn Bedding to find a local pickup service.
Are there any shipping fees?
Brooklyn Bedding offers free shipping if you’re within the United States. Shipping to Alaska and Hawaii will cost extra. You’ll need to pay $125 per mattress. They also deliver to Canada, but their shipping fees cost up to $250.
